2. Use Header Tags for Headings
You should always use subheadings when you are writing an article. You can do this by using h2 tags. This helps keep your ideas organized and much easier to read, it also provides a great place to put your keywords. Search engines pay special attention to keywords placed in header tags, so try to use your keyword into a subheading to get it noticed by search engine.

4. Keyword Density
In order to efficiently write a search engine friendly and keyword rich article, the article should be thick or filled with the target keywords or focus keyword phrases. On average an SEO article should have a keyword density between 1 – 4 %. To figure out the keyword density of an article, multiply the number of times your keyword or keyword phrases appear in your article, divide that number by the word count of the article. 5. Use LSI Keywords
It is important to use relevant LSI keywords in your article so that users can find your article using related terms. It also help you cover the topic in depth as you are going to add additional context while using these related keywords.
